Hungary is the small nation the legacy media and the worldwide elite love to hate.

“Fascist,” per Germany’s Der Speigel; “racists and xenophobes,” say high UN officers.

But in defying the unfettered immigration insurance policies and climate-change histrionics that different European Union international locations fell for, Hungary has been a beacon of common sense the world over.

And once I visited Budapest final week, I found that its younger people possess a highly effective conservative spine sturdy enough to resist the focused assaults coming their approach.

I used to be there to attend Hungary’s fifth annual Conservative Political Action Conference, hosted by the Center for Fundamental Rights.

It featured a keynote speech from Prime Minister Viktor Orbán, who’s dealing with a powerful battle towards a center-right challenger in an April parliamentary election that would usher him out of workplace after 16 years in energy.

“Brussels has put Europe in an unsustainable situation,” Orbán lamented.

“For Brussels, it is not the European people who come first; it is the migrants,” he continued. “Terrorist threats, crime, antisemitism, anti-Christianity and economic turmoil: This is what their policies have brought.”

He ended on a rhetorical observe acquainted to Americans: “We will make Europe great again!”

The American affect on the occasion was overwhelming, beginning with the singing of “The Star-Spangled Banner” alongside that of Hungary’s national anthem.

And whereas the younger CPAC attendees I spoke to expressed deep appreciation of the United States, and great affection for President Donald Trump, they have been firmly targeted on Hungary’s pursuits and Hungary’s future — with or with out Orbán in charge.

The media’s framing of Hungarian conservatives as modern-day Nazis or motivated by hatred, they are saying, is an unfair marketing campaign that ignores their respectable considerations about national sovereignty.

“The whole globalist fake news media machine has done nothing but spread lies about Hungary in the past one and a half decades,” mentioned Dornfeld László, 34.

“Hungary pursues a policy based on its own national interests,” he added. “The deep state and Brussels are unhappy with Hungary being able to operate like that. They want an obedient puppet.”

These younger conservatives reward Orbán for refusing to bend the knee to international bureaucrats if it meant risking the security of his own people.

“Security is extremely important for young people,” mentioned Péntek Luca, 16. “In our rapidly changing world, it is hard to plan anything, but here in Hungary, I can feel an encouraging stability.”

The primary adversary these conservatives see isn’t within their nation’s borders, however a international energy they really feel stands in the way in which of Hungary’s progress: the EU.

“The European Union is controlled by envy,” 24-year-old Dr. Püsök Kata advised me. “The EU wants to be America. They’re trying to build an empire . . . and sometimes we feel like here in Hungary we are forgotten about.”

Western Europe’s financial alliance “started as an American-like project, but it ended up being like the Soviet Union,” mentioned Kocsis Levente, 21.

Most Americans are unaware that Hungary’s national populists are the punching bag of Europe’s liberal elite.

I felt an surprising kinship with them: As a Trump-supporting former Democrat, I perceive what it looks like to be misrepresented, to have your motives questioned, to be falsely labeled as holding sympathy for evil causes.

Just like me, each slanderous blow they obtain solely strengthens their resolve to remain heading in the right direction with their conservative ideas and battle for his or her nation’s future towards a devouring leftist energy.

Through the eyes of these exceptional younger Hungarians, I noticed a deep love for his or her nation — a uncommon commodity in Europe nowadays.

Wednesday marks the thirty sixth anniversary of Hungary’s first parliamentary election after the autumn of the Soviet Union.

The younger adults I spoke to have been born into freedom, however the victims of communism from earlier generations imbued them with classes and warnings in regards to the risks of totalitarian rule.

No marvel they’re so strident towards a political physique outdoors Hungary’s borders dictating its ambitions, simply as Moscow did many years in the past.

Regardless of the mainstream-media messaging, I discovered no monsters amongst Hungary’s conservatives.

Instead, I witnessed extremely smart, purpose-driven, thoughtful younger people who’re pushed to battle the bureaucratic juggernaut standing of their approach.

In Hungary, the kids are alright.
